I Couldn’t Leave Them Behind, So I Broke My Own Rule

I couldn’t leave them behind, so I broke my own rule.

My rule of trying to re-design my interiors, using what I already had in the house.

I was doing pretty good, until I saw these.

Temptation set in, and it won.

Blue and White Ginger Jar Lamp - Housepitality Designs

I was in HomeGoods searching for a mirror for my son’s new home.

As I was approaching the area where the mirrors were, I passed the lamp department.

And there they were.

Ralph Lauren Ginger Jar Lamps - Housepitality Designs

I have some small ginger jars by Ralph Lauren Home that are currently on my mantel

and these lamps are from the same collection.

Blue and White/Sofa Table - Housepitality Designs

Actually, I have quite a few things from this collection and thought,

is it too much? Too many things “matchy-matchy” ?

Then again . . . they may not land in the same area

as the other items in the collection. And then again, maybe so.

Blue and White/Sofa Table - Housepitality Designs

The lamps spoke to me in more ways than one, and they jumped into the cart.

Blue and White/Sofa Table - Housepitality Designs

The tall scrolled iron lamps there previously on the sofa table.

They have been relocated.

My hubby loves the lower profile of these lamps.

Ralph Lauren Lamps/Great Room - Housepitality Designs

I have to agree that I love the lower profile of these lamps on the sofa table too.

Not to mention, the colors.

Blue and White/Sofa Table - Housepitality Designs

As it is always the case, once you bring  something new into a room,

the domino effect happens. Things were moved around the house a bit.

Great Room - Housepitality Designs

Love that game of Dominos.

Great Room - Housepitality Designs

I have ditched Monopoly and Dominos has taken its place this week.
